Concrete Walkway Trip Hazard Removed in Spring Hill, FL
The concrete walkway at Charlie’s home in Spring Hill, FL, had gradually settled over time, resulting in an uneven surface that created multiple tripping hazards between the slabs. In need of a reliable repair solution, he reached out to us at LRE Foundation Repair to schedule a free inspection with one of our expert Design Specialists. After examining the tripping hazards, Charlie chose to have our team carefully lift, level, and stabilize the sunken concrete slabs using our PolyLevel solution.
Injected directly beneath the concrete, the two-part polyurethane foam quickly expands to fill voids, stabilize the surrounding soil, and precisely lift the concrete back to its proper level. In just a matter of minutes, Charlie’s concrete walkway was fully restored to a safe, even surface—providing him with lasting peace of mind.
Leveling Concrete Walkway Slab in Brooksville, FL
In Brooksville, FL, Charlie’s concrete walkway had settled significantly, with the slabs having become severely uneven with each other, creating a problematic tripping hazard. In need of an effective repair solution, Charlie asked us at LRE Foundation Repair for help. After having our Design Specialist conduct a complimentary inspection, it was discovered that the underlying soil had eroded and washed away over time, causing the slabs to sink. Our team stepped in and utilized our Two-Part Concrete Protection System to completely lift, level, and stabilize the slabs. PolyLevel was first injected beneath the slabs to level them back to their proper, even level. NexusPro was then applied to the control joints between the slabs in order to safeguard against water from intruding beneath them. Within just a short amount of time, Charlie’s concrete walkway was restored to its original, safe level and permanently stabilized against further settlement.

Leveling Uneven Walkway in Oldsmar, FL
Don F. from Oldsmar, Florida, noticed that the concrete walkway leading up to his home's front porch had become uneven and posed a trip hazard. He also noticed that cracks had developed in the concrete slabs. Don reached out to LRE Foundation Repair to find out how he could save the concrete from getting worse. One of LRE's Design Specialists conducted a thorough inspection and determined that soil settlement had caused the concrete slabs to sink and crack. To address this issue, the specialist recommended the Two-Part Concrete Protection System to repair Don's concrete. This solution included PolyLevel injection to restore the slabs to their proper level and NexusPro to seal the cracks and control joints, preventing further damage and water intrusion. After the homeowner approved the plan, LRE implemented the recommended solutions. They ensured that Don's walkway was even and sealed, removing the trip hazard and permanently stabilizing his home's walkway.
